8 (21.23) A study of the effect of exposure to color ( red or blue) on the ability to solve puzzles used 40 subjects. Half the subjects were asked to solve a series of puzzles while in a red colored environment. The other half were asked to solve the same series of puzzles while in a blue-colored environment. The 20 subjects in the red-colored environment had a mean time for solving the puzzles of 9.63 seconds with standard deviation 3.43 ; the 20 subjects in the blue-colored environment had a mean time of 15.88 seconds with standard deviation 8,69 The two-sample t statistic for comparing the population means has value (0.001) eBookExplanation / Answer
